第二个vue程序之判断结构
2022/1/23 12:04:45
本文主要是介绍第二个vue程序之判断结构,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
通过上一篇文章的了解,我们知道了vue的基本结构与用法,这一篇我们来学习,怎么在vue中使用判断结构。
首先,学后端的我对于判断结构实在是再熟悉不过了,无非就是if,else if,else这种
在vue中,其实是延续了我们的后端的这种写法,只不过将if改为了v-if将else if 变成了v-else-if将else改为了v-else
也就是将所有的方法前放了一个vue的v 其他的其他的空格处用“-”连了起来,其他基本上什么都没有变
那么我们利用这一点,来写一个判断的vue程序
我的程序如下
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> </head> <body> <div id="app"> <h1 v-if="type==='A'">A</h1> <h1 v-else-if="type==='B'">B</h1> <h1 v-else>C</h1> </div> <script src="https://cdn.jsdelivr.net/npm/vue@2"></script> <script> var vm =new Vue({ el:"#app", data:{ //message:"hello,vue!" type:'A' } }); </script> </body> </html>
可以看到,我这个程序只是将以前的语句修改了一下,将massage变成了type,其他的照常写就行
可以看到我们显示的结果为A
要动态的改变type的值为B
(在浏览器中点击键盘f12键调出窗口,点击console窗口在里面输入即可,这里我们创建的vue对象为vm,数据data里面赋值的是type,所以调用的时候就是vm.type=‘’即可
var vm =new Vue({ type:'A'
),则判断的则为B
同样要是不为A或B则为C
到这,判断结构的基础算是讲完了,当然还有许多的花样,可以点击官网详细学习
这篇关于第二个vue程序之判断结构的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!
- 2025-01-04React 19 来了!新的编译器简直太棒了!
- 2025-01-032025年Node.js与PHP大比拼:挑选最适合的后端技术进行现代web开发
- 2025-01-03?? 用 Gemini API、Next.js 和 TailwindCSS 快速搭建 AI 推文生成项目 ??
- 2024-12-31Vue CLI多环境配置学习入门
- 2024-12-31Vue CLI学习入门:一步一步搭建你的第一个Vue项目
- 2024-12-31Vue3公共组件学习入门:从零开始搭建实用组件库
- 2024-12-31Vue3公共组件学习入门教程
- 2024-12-31Vue3学习入门:新手必读教程
- 2024-12-31Vue3学习入门:初学者必备指南
- 2024-12-30Vue CLI多环境配置教程:轻松入门指南